react的开发工具

React是一种流行的JavaScript库,用于构建用户界面。它提供了一套强大的开发工具,使开发人员能够更轻松地创建交互式和可重用的UI组件。在本文中,我们将探讨一些与React开发工具相关的关键字。

首先,让我们来谈谈React开发工具中最常用的工具之一:React开发者工具。这是一个浏览器扩展,可让开发人员检查和调试React组件层次结构。它提供了一个直观的界面,显示组件的层次结构、状态和属性。开发人员可以轻松地检查组件的渲染和更新过程,以及组件之间的数据流。

另一个重要的React开发工具是Webpack。它是一个模块打包工具,可以将React应用程序的所有依赖项打包到一个或多个文件中。Webpack还提供了许多有用的功能,如代码拆分、热模块替换和代码优化。使用Webpack,开发人员可以更好地组织和管理React应用程序的代码。

除了Webpack,Babel也是React开发工具中不可或缺的一部分。Babel是一个JavaScript编译器,可以将最新的JavaScript语法转换为浏览器可以理解的旧版本。这对于使用React的开发人员来说尤为重要,因为React使用了一些最新的JavaScript语法和特性。通过使用Babel,开发人员可以确保他们的React应用程序在各种浏览器中都能正常运行。

另一个与React开发工具相关的关键字是ESLint。ESLint是一个JavaScript静态代码分析工具,可以帮助开发人员发现和修复代码中的潜在问题。它提供了一套可配置的规则,用于检查代码的质量和一致性。使用ESLint,开发人员可以确保他们的React应用程序符合最佳实践,并避免常见的错误和漏洞。

最后,我们来谈谈React Native。React Native是一个用于构建原生移动应用程序的框架,它使用React的开发模型和工具。开发人员可以使用React Native开发工具来创建跨平台的移动应用程序,只需编写一次代码即可在iOS和Android上运行。这使得开发人员能够更高效地构建和维护移动应用程序,同时享受React的强大功能和开发工具。

综上所述,React开发工具为开发人员提供了许多便利和功能,使他们能够更轻松地构建和维护React应用程序。无论是React开发者工具、Webpack、Babel、ESLint还是React Native,它们都在不同的方面提供了帮助和支持。通过熟练掌握这些工具,开发人员可以更加高效地开发出高质量的React应用程序。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

(0)
上一篇 2024年2月23日 上午11:08
下一篇 2024年2月24日 上午9:08

相关推荐